Equity, Inclusion, Diversity and Linguistics Consultant I
Kaiser Permanente is seeking an Equity, Inclusion, Diversity and Linguistics Consultant I to support initiatives that promote health equity, cultural responsiveness, and language access across diverse patient populations. This role helps improve patient care by enhancing clinical communication, supporting regulatory compliance, and contributing to language access programs. Working with cross-functional stakeholders and senior consultants, the incumbent will assist with project planning, research, analysis, presentations, and implementation of strategic initiatives. The ideal candidate has strong communication, collaboration, and organizational skills, along with experience in healthcare, diversity and inclusion, health equity, language services, or consulting. A commitment to continuous learning and advancing equitable, inclusive care is essential.
